GST revenue increases by 11% to Rs 1.6 lakh crore in August

New Delhi, Sep 1: GST revenue has increased by 11 per cent on an annual basis in August 2023. Revenue Secretary Sanjay Malhotra gave this information on Friday. In August 2022, Rs 1,43,612 crore was collected from Goods and Services Tax (GST).

Malhotra told reporters, roughly, there has been an increase of 11 per cent on an annual basis. With this 11 per cent increase, roughly the collection would be around Rs 1.60 lakh crore. He was replying to a question on the expected GST revenue for August, the figure of which will be released by Friday evening.

“Roughly numbers are in the range of 11 per cent year-on-year growth as in earlier months,” Malhotra told reporters.

Malhotra said that the GDP in the April-June quarter was 7.8 per cent. GST revenue increased by more than 11 per cent in the June quarter. This means that the tax-GDP ratio is more than 1.3.
